About (5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ate
(5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ate (PubChem CID 2584441) has the molecular formula C14H12N2O4S
and a molecular weight of 304.33 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is (5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ate.

What is the SMILES notation for (5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ate?
The canonical SMILES for (5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ate is Cc1cc(C(=O)OCc2cc(=O)n3ccsc3n2)c(C)o1.
What is the InChIKey of (5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ate?
The InChIKey is AFZOFPDTDHVNGH-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C14H12N2O4S/c1-8-5-11(9(2)20-8)13(18)19-7-10-6-12(17)16-3-4-21-14(16)15-10/h3-6H,7H2,1-2H3.
What are the key properties of (5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ate?
(5-oxo-[1,3]thiazolo[3,2-a]pyrimidin-7-yl)methyl 2,5-dimethylfuran-3-carboxylate has a molecular weight of 304.33 g/mol, XLogP of 2.32, 3 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 7 hydrogen bond acceptors.
